Associate Automation Engineer Jobs in Zambia

Overview of the Job

An Associate Automation Engineer plays a critical role in the integration and optimization of automation systems within various industries. This position involves designing, implementing, and maintaining automation solutions that enhance operational efficiency, reduce costs, and improve productivity. In Zambia, the demand for Associate Automation Engineers is growing, driven by the expanding manufacturing, mining, and technology sectors that seek to leverage automation to remain competitive.

Job Description

An Associate Automation Engineer in Zambia is responsible for developing and managing automation systems that streamline industrial processes. This involves working with various control systems, programmable logic controllers (PLCs), and other automation technologies. The role requires a combination of technical expertise, problem-solving skills, and the ability to work collaboratively with other engineers and stakeholders to achieve project goals.

Job Roles & Responsibilities

The roles and responsibilities of an Associate Automation Engineer in Zambia are diverse and integral to the successful implementation of automation projects. Key responsibilities include:

  • System Design and Implementation: Design and develop automation systems that meet the specific needs of the organization. This includes selecting appropriate hardware and software, programming PLCs, and configuring control systems.

  • Maintenance and Troubleshooting: Ensure the smooth operation of automation systems by performing regular maintenance and troubleshooting any issues that arise. This involves diagnosing problems, implementing solutions, and optimizing system performance.

  • Project Management: Manage automation projects from conception to completion, ensuring that they are delivered on time and within budget. This includes planning, coordinating with other team members, and monitoring progress.

  • Documentation and Reporting: Prepare detailed documentation for automation systems, including design specifications, user manuals, and maintenance logs. Generate reports on system performance and project status for management and stakeholders.

  • Collaboration: Work closely with other engineers, technicians, and production staff to ensure that automation solutions are integrated seamlessly into existing processes. Provide technical support and training to team members as needed.

  • Compliance and Safety: Ensure that all automation systems comply with relevant industry standards and safety regulations. Conduct risk assessments and implement safety measures to protect personnel and equipment.

  • Continuous Improvement: Identify opportunities for process improvement and innovation within the organization. Stay updated with the latest advancements in automation technology and apply new techniques to enhance system efficiency.


Skills Needed for the Job

To excel as an Associate Automation Engineer in Zambia, individuals must possess a range of technical and soft skills. Essential skills include:

  • Technical Proficiency: Strong understanding of automation technologies, including PLCs, SCADA systems, and HMI interfaces. Proficiency in programming languages such as ladder logic, Python, and C++.

  • Problem-Solving: Ability to diagnose and resolve technical issues quickly and efficiently. Strong analytical skills to identify root causes and implement effective solutions.

  • Project Management: Excellent project management skills to handle multiple projects simultaneously, ensuring timely and successful completion.

  • Communication: Effective verbal and written communication skills to convey technical information to non-technical stakeholders and collaborate with team members.

  • Attention to Detail: Precision in designing and implementing automation systems to ensure reliability and accuracy.

  • Adaptability: Ability to adapt to new technologies and changing project requirements. Willingness to continuously learn and upgrade skills.

  • Teamwork: Strong interpersonal skills to work collaboratively with diverse teams and foster a positive working environment.


Qualifications Needed for the Job

To become an Associate Automation Engineer in Zambia, individuals must meet specific educational and professional qualifications:

  • Education: A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Automation Engineering, or a related field is typically required. Advanced degrees or specialized certifications in automation can be advantageous.

  • Professional Experience: Relevant experience in automation engineering, control systems, or a related field is highly valued. Internships or entry-level positions in automation can provide valuable practical experience.

  • Certifications: Professional certifications such as Certified Automation Professional (CAP) from the International Society of Automation (ISA) can enhance job prospects and demonstrate expertise.

  • Continuous Education: Engaging in continuous education through workshops, seminars, and online courses is essential to stay updated with the latest trends and advancements in automation technology.

Suggestions on Where to Find Associate Automation Engineer Jobs in Zambia

Finding Associate Automation Engineer jobs in Zambia requires a strategic approach and leveraging various resources. Here are some effective strategies to explore:

  1. Job Portals: Utilize online job portals such as Go Zambia Jobs, Jobweb Zambia, and Careers Zambia to search for Associate Automation Engineer job listings. These platforms often have a wide range of job postings across various industries.

  2. Company Websites: Check the career pages of major corporations, manufacturing companies, and technology firms in Zambia. Companies like Zambezi Automation, Copperbelt Energy Corporation, and ZESCO Limited frequently list job openings on their websites.

  3. Professional Associations: Join professional associations such as the Engineering Institution of Zambia (EIZ) and the International Society of Automation (ISA). These organizations often have job boards and networking events that can help you discover job opportunities.

  4. Networking: Attend industry conferences, seminars, and networking events to connect with professionals in the automation field. Building relationships with peers and industry leaders can lead to job referrals and opportunities.

  5. Recruitment Agencies: Register with recruitment agencies that specialize in engineering and technology roles. These agencies often have exclusive job listings and can match you with suitable positions.

  6. Social Media: Use professional social media platforms like LinkedIn to search for job postings and connect with hiring managers. Follow companies and join industry groups to stay updated on job opportunities.

  7. University Career Services: If you are a recent graduate, take advantage of your university’s career services office. They often have job listings, career fairs, and resources to help you find a job.

  8. Direct Applications: Proactively reach out to companies and automation firms with your resume and cover letter, even if they do not have current job postings. Express your interest in potential openings and demonstrate your qualifications.
